App Description

Analog design assistant with calculators, guides & IC data for op-amps.

Operational Amplifiers Pro is your essential tool for designing and analyzing circuits using op-amps. Whether you're a student, electronics enthusiast, or experienced engineer, this app helps you create, calculate, and understand a wide variety of op-amp–based circuits with ease.

Use it as a practical reference when developing projects, building prototypes, or studying amplifier configurations. The app also includes technical data on popular operational amplifier and comparator series — making it a handy guide for both design and selection.

Key Features:
• Interactive calculators for common op-amp circuits
• Step-by-step explanations and formulas
• Reference info on op-amps and comparators
• Ideal for learning, prototyping, or quick checks
• Light and dark mode support
• Available in 11 languages: English, French, German, Indonesian, Italian, Polish, Portuguese, Russian, Spanish, Turkish, and Ukrainian
